MGPS stands for Medical Gas Pipeline System. It is a network of pipelines, source equipment, valves, alarms, pressure regulators, terminal outlets, and control systems used to deliver medical gases inside healthcare facilities.
The system connects the medical gas source to different hospital departments. These departments may include ICUs, emergency rooms, operation theatres, recovery rooms, general wards, private rooms, and procedure areas.
A properly installed MGPS helps ensure that medical gases are available where they are needed, when they are needed.

Key Components of an MGPS
An MGPS is made of several important parts. Each part has a specific role in the safe movement and control of medical gases.
The gas source may include oxygen cylinders, manifolds, liquid oxygen tanks, medical air compressors, vacuum pumps, or other source systems based on the hospital’s requirements. The source is the starting point of the entire system.
Medical gas pipelines are commonly installed using suitable quality copper pipes. These pipelines carry gases from the source room to different hospital areas. Proper routing, joining, and installation are very important for safe performance.
A manifold system helps connect multiple cylinders and manage gas supply. It may include pressure control and changeover arrangements so that the gas supply can continue smoothly.
Area valve service units help control the gas supply to specific zones or departments. In case maintenance is required in one area, the valve unit helps isolate that area without disturbing the complete system.
Terminal Units or Gas Outlets
Terminal units are the final access points where doctors, nurses, or medical equipment connect to the gas supply. These outlets are installed near patient beds, operation tables, ICU beds, and treatment areas.
MGPS alarm systems alert hospital staff when there is a pressure issue or supply problem. This allows quick action and better monitoring of the medical gas network.
In patient rooms and ICUs, gas outlets are often integrated with hospital bed head panel systems. These panels keep gas outlets, electrical points, nurse call systems, and lighting controls organized near the patient bed.

A medical gas pipeline system cannot be installed like a normal utility line. It needs proper planning, careful execution, and attention to safety. Professional MGPS installation services support the complete process from design understanding to final setup.
Before installation begins, the hospital layout must be studied carefully. The number of beds, departments, oxygen demand, ICU requirements, operation theatre needs, and future expansion plans should be considered.
This helps decide the right pipeline route, number of outlets, source capacity, valve positions, alarm locations, and room-wise distribution.
Every hospital is different. A small nursing home may need a simple setup, while a multi-speciality hospital may need a larger and more advanced MGPS.
Proper planning helps create a system that matches the hospital’s real usage. It also helps avoid unnecessary clutter, poor access points, and future modification costs.
Safe Pipeline Installation
Pipeline installation is one of the most important parts of MGPS work. The pipeline must be properly routed, supported, joined, and protected. A clean and organized installation makes the system easier to operate and maintain.
Gas outlets should be placed where medical staff can easily access them. In ICUs and operation theatres, outlet planning is especially important because multiple devices may need gas connections at the same time.
Good outlet placement improves workflow and reduces delays during treatment.
Testing and Commissioning Support
After installation, the system should be tested carefully before regular use. Testing helps check pressure performance, leakage concerns, outlet connection, valve function, alarm response, and system readiness.
Commissioning support gives hospitals more confidence before the MGPS is used for patient care.
